B4160 is the HCPCS Level II code for Enteral formula, for pediatrics, nutritionally complete calorically dense (equal to or greater than 0.7 kcal/ml) with intact nutrients, includes proteins, fats, carbohydrates, vitamins and minerals, may include fiber, administered through an enteral feeding tube, 100 calories = 1 unit (2026). It belongs to Section B — Enteral & Parenteral Therapy. Under Medicare, its coverage status is: Special coverage instructions apply. Part B pricing methodology: Carrier priced.
